I've found a reason for a <br/> tag in my DTD, and I wonder how to implement it in the XSL (to FO). So far, I have used a list tag for the task: <list style="none"> <item>Microsoft Corporation Worldwide</item> <item>One Microsoft Way</item> <item>Redmond, WA 98052-6399</item> <item>USA</item> <item>Tel: (425) 882-8080</item> <item>E-fax: (425) 706-7329</item> <item>Web: http://www.microsoft.com/</item> </list> Another example: <header>Financial Information</header> <list style="none"> <item>Fiscal Year ending June 2000</item> <item>Net revenue $22.96 billion</item> <item>Net income $9.42 billion</item> </list> The list comes out without bullets or numbers. It works, but neither is conceptually a list, or what would you say? Perhaps it's a minor problem, but if there's a solution I'd be happy to know about it. I'd rather have it more like in XHTML: a <br/> tag to use whenever you need in paragraphs. I wonder how to implement a <br/> tag in FO, if that is possible.
